                                  • flohackF Offline
                                    flohack
                                    last edited by

                                    Ok guys can you try the following:

                                    • Let it boot & fail
                                    • Long-press Vol-Down & Power to enter fastboot
                                    • select Recovery with up/down-key and power
                                    • Let it boot into recovery and execute the following command on your host: adb pull /sys/fs/pstore/console-ramoops

                                    Post this file to a pastebin and ping me back πŸ˜‰

                                        • flohackF Offline
                                          flohack @agates
                                          last edited by

                                          @agates can you boot into recovery (Is it UBports recovery at least?) and then adb shell into it. Can you:

                                          • mount /system_root
                                          • ls -la /system_root, it should have a typical Linux appearance
                                          • ls -la /system_root/var/lib/lxc/android, it should show android-rootfs.img
